Koalas are about as cute as cute gets, and appar- ently someone was trying to smuggle one home. Australian authorities were checking a woman’s bags at a customs station recently when they asked her if she had anything to declare. The woman didn’t say anything but she did hand officers a green canvas bag, the contents of which ap- peared to be moving. Police unzipped the bag and they found a baby koala inside. The woman told police she found the creature on a road somewhere and was trying to nurse the little guy back to health. Koalas are an endangered and protected species in Oz and a koala group showed up to collect the fuzzy little bugger. The koala, believed to be about six months of age, is in good health, but was a little dehydrated. They named him Alfred. Koala smuggler gets nabbed by Oz-ciffers Thanks a ton fellas!
